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9695528 5374785516 11205535 53 6872593417
4406861533 358105875 16777
4406861533 358105875 16777
0271 668954697 248838
All about undefined
Interested in learning more?
4406861533 358105875 16777
0271 668954697 248838
See more
622972 513 754
16608718 35990153 331088
See more
863 5401878919 1929
095989 520 063929873 093024
See more